Yard sprinkler installation services involve setting up an efficient irrigation system that ensures a property’s lawn and landscaped areas receive consistent and adequate watering. This process typically includes designing a layout tailored to the property's size and shape, installing underground piping, and placing sprinkler heads in optimal locations. The goal is to create a system that evenly distributes water across the yard, reducing manual watering efforts and promoting healthy plant growth. Experienced local contractors handle all aspects of installation, ensuring the system functions properly and minimizes water waste.
Many homeowners turn to sprinkler installation services to address common issues such as uneven watering, dry patches, or over-reliance on manual watering methods. An appropriately installed sprinkler system helps maintain a lush, green yard without the need for constant attention. It can also help prevent problems like overwatering, which may lead to water runoff or plant damage, and underwatering, which can cause grass and plants to become stressed or die. These systems are especially beneficial for properties with large lawns or irregular landscaping that makes manual watering inefficient or impractical.

The overview below groups typical Yard Sprinkler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or sprinkler system repairs or adjustments often range from $150 to $400. Many routine fixes fall within this band, though prices can vary based on the specific issue and system complexity.
Partial System Installation - Installing new sprinkler zones or replacing sections of an existing system usually costs between $600 and $2,000. Most projects in this range are straightforward, with larger or more intricate setups reaching higher costs.
Full System Replacement - Replacing an entire sprinkler system generally falls between $2,500 and $5,000. While many full replacements are within this range, larger or more complex landscapes can push costs above $5,000.
Complex or Custom Projects - Highly customized or extensive irrigation systems can exceed $5,000, with some larger, more complex projects reaching $10,000+ depending on scope and site conditions. These are less common but represent the upper end of typical cost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in installing a yard sprinkler system? Local contractors typically assess the landscape, plan the layout, and install piping, valves, and sprinkler heads to ensure even coverage throughout the yard.
Can a yard sprinkler system be customized for specific yard features? Yes, service providers can tailor sprinkler layouts to accommodate features like gardens, trees, and uneven terrain for optimal watering.
What types of sprinkler heads are available for installation? There are various options including spray heads, rotor heads, and drip emitters, which local pros can recommend based on the yard's watering needs.
How do local contractors ensure proper coverage with a sprinkler system? They design the layout to prevent overlaps and dry spots, adjusting head placement and spray patterns as needed during installation.
